Chandler, Arizona blends a polished suburban feel with pockets of historic charm, especially around its walkable downtown where you’ll find local restaurants, coffee spots, and frequent community events. Many people like the city’s well-kept neighborhoods, extensive parks, and easy access to trails and lakeside recreation a short drive away. When the sun is high, early and late outings fit naturally into the daily rhythm, and patios still stay popular with a bit of shade.
For commuters, Chandler sits close to major freeways and neighboring job centers, making it straightforward to reach Tempe, Mesa, Phoenix, and the broader East Valley. Everyday conveniences are abundant, from large shopping corridors to libraries, sports facilities, and family-friendly attractions. Housing options range from newer master-planned communities and townhomes to established single-family neighborhoods, with rentals spread throughout the city. The overall vibe is calm and practical, with plenty to do without losing that relaxed, residential comfort.

A realistic closing timeline for Chandler, AZ during March 2026
If you only remember one closed data point right now, make it this a typical sale took 47 days last month, and recent offers landed around 97.64% of asking last month. Typical closed pricing was $490,000 last month.
Where people get this wrong is treating the offer date like the finish line, then scrambling through inspections, appraisal, and logistics. Some metrics were not reported for this period.
Back into your target move date using the typical 47-day pace, then add your own buffer so you are not forced into rushed decisions in Chandler, AZ. When you find a home you like, set your offer terms so the seller sees a clear path to close, because clean timing can matter as much as price. If you need flexibility, plan it upfront rather than asking late, when the deal has less patience for surprises.
